What Are Sims 4 Challenges?
If you’ve ever felt like your gameplay in The Sims 4 is becoming repetitive, Sims 4 challenges are the perfect solution. These challenges are community-created gameplay rules and objectives that push players to think creatively, tell compelling stories, and explore aspects of the game they might otherwise ignore.
Sims 4 challenges transform a simple life simulation into a structured, goal-oriented experience. Whether you enjoy storytelling, strategy, or chaos, there’s a challenge designed for your play style.

The Most Popular Sims 4 Challenges
Legacy Challenge
The Legacy Challenge is one of the oldest and most iconic Sims 4 challenges. The goal is to build a family legacy across ten generations, starting from nothing.
You begin with a single Sim and minimal funds, then grow your family, build a home, and pass down wealth and traits through generations.
Rules typically include:
- No cheating (money cheats are not allowed)
- Stick with one bloodline
- Track each generation’s progress
This challenge is perfect for players who enjoy long-term storytelling and character development.
100 Baby Challenge
The 100 Baby Challenge is chaotic, hilarious, and incredibly addictive. The objective is simple: have 100 babies with one matriarch.
However, the rules make it difficult:
- You cannot use the same partner more than once
- Children must age up only after completing goals
- You must manage finances without cheats
This challenge tests your multitasking and management skills while creating endless funny moments.
Rags to Riches Challenge
In this challenge, your Sim starts with zero money and must build a life from absolutely nothing.
You typically:
- Begin on an empty lot
- Have no job initially
- Earn money through fishing, gardening, or odd jobs
It’s one of the most realistic and satisfying challenges, as every success feels earned.
Not So Berry Challenge
The Not So Berry Challenge adds a colorful twist to legacy gameplay. Each generation is based on a specific color and personality traits.
For example:
- One generation may focus on science careers
- Another may prioritize romance or mischief
- Each has unique rules and goals
This challenge is perfect for players who enjoy structured storytelling with a creative theme.
Black Widow Challenge
This darker challenge focuses on manipulation and wealth-building through relationships.
Your Sim must:
- Marry wealthy partners
- Eliminate them (through in-game means)
- Inherit their money
It’s dramatic, controversial, and perfect for storytelling-focused players.
Fun and Unique Sims 4 Challenges You Should Try
Runaway Teen Challenge
In this challenge, you play as a teenager who has run away from home and must survive independently.
Restrictions include:
- No adult assistance
- Limited access to jobs
- Focus on survival skills
This adds a realistic and emotional layer to gameplay.
Apocalypse Challenge
The Apocalypse Challenge introduces strict rules that simulate a dystopian world.
You must:
- Rebuild society
- Unlock careers gradually
- Follow complex restrictions
It’s a strategic challenge that requires patience and planning.
Decades Challenge
Love history? The Decades Challenge lets you play through different historical eras, starting from the 1890s or earlier.
Each decade comes with:
- Specific clothing styles
- Limited technology
- Unique social rules
This challenge is perfect for players who enjoy immersive storytelling and realism.
Disney Princess Challenge
This fun and creative challenge is inspired by classic fairy tales.
Each generation represents a different princess, with rules based on their story. It’s great for players who enjoy whimsical storytelling and themed gameplay.
Sims 4 Challenges for Beginners
If you’re new to Sims challenges, starting with simpler ones can help you get used to structured gameplay.
Single Parent Challenge
Raise a child or multiple children as a single parent with limited resources. It’s straightforward but still engaging.
Build Newcrest Challenge
Instead of focusing on Sims, this challenge is about building an entire world from scratch.
You must:
- Create families
- Build homes and community lots
- Develop a functioning neighborhood
It’s ideal for creative builders.
No Skills No Problem Challenge
In this challenge, your Sim cannot intentionally build skills but must still succeed in life.
It forces you to think outside the box and rely on unconventional methods.
Tips to Succeed in Sims 4 Challenges
Plan Ahead
Most challenges require long-term strategy. Before starting, read the rules carefully and plan your gameplay.
Stay Organized
Keep track of:
- Generations
- Goals
- Achievements
This is especially important for legacy-style challenges.
Embrace Storytelling
The best Sims 4 challenges are not just about completing objectives—they’re about telling a story. Add personality to your Sims and make decisions that enhance the narrative.
Avoid Cheats
While it may be tempting to use cheats, they defeat the purpose of most challenges. The difficulty is what makes them fun and rewarding.
Experiment with Mods
Mods can enhance your challenge experience by adding realism, new interactions, and expanded gameplay options.

Creating Your Own Sims 4 Challenge
One of the best things about the Sims community is creativity. You can design your own challenge and share it online.
Steps to create a challenge:
- Define a unique concept
- Set clear rules
- Add goals and restrictions
- Test gameplay
- Share with the community
If your challenge is unique and fun, it can quickly gain popularity.
